阿里云 MySQL 之所以“快”,主要是因为它结合了 高性能硬件、优化的网络架构、智能的数据库引擎优化 以及 云计算平台的整体优化。下面从多个角度来详细解释为什么阿里云 MySQL 性能表现优异:
🚀 一、底层基础设施优化
1. SSD 磁盘 + 高性能存储架构
- 阿里云 MySQL 默认使用 高速 SSD 存储,相比传统机械硬盘(HDD)I/O 性能提升数十倍。
- 支持 本地 SSD 盘 和 云盘(如ESSD),其中 ESSD 是阿里云自研的增强型固态硬盘,性能可达到百万级 IOPS。
2. 高性能服务器配置
- 提供多种规格实例(从小型到大型),支持高内存、多核 CPU 的配置,满足不同业务需求。
- 支持专属主机组、独占宿主机资源,避免资源争抢。
🌐 二、网络优化
1. 内网访问零延迟
- 应用服务器和数据库部署在同一个 VPC 内网中,数据传输延迟极低,带宽高。
- 公网访问也通过阿里云 CDN 和专线优化,降低延迟。
2. VPC + SLB 高效调度
- 结合阿里云专有网络(VPC)和负载均衡(SLB),实现高效的请求调度与网络隔离。
⚙️ 三、MySQL 引擎层面优化
1. 基于官方 MySQL 的深度定制
- 阿里云 RDS for MySQL 基于官方版本进行优化,例如:
- 查询缓存优化
- InnoDB 引擎调优
- 并发连接处理能力增强
2. 参数自动调优
- 根据实例规格自动设置最优的 MySQL 配置参数(如 buffer pool、最大连接数等)。
- 用户也可以自定义参数组进行精细化调整。
📈 四、读写分离与高可用架构
1. 读写分离
- 支持 主实例 + 多个只读实例 架构,自动将读请求分发到只读副本,减轻主库压力。
- 自动路由、负载均衡,提升整体吞吐量。
2. 多可用区部署
- 主从节点可以跨可用区部署,保障高可用性。
- 故障自动切换(HA),切换时间短,对业务影响小。
🔒 五、安全与稳定保障
1. 自动备份与恢复
- 支持每日自动备份 + Binlog 实时备份,恢复精度可达秒级。
- 支持跨地域备份容灾。
2. 监控与告警
- 提供实时性能监控(CPU、内存、IO、QPS、TPS 等)。
- 支持 SQL 审计、慢查询日志分析,帮助定位瓶颈。
🧠 六、智能诊断与运维支持
1. DAS 智能数据库管家
- 阿里云 DAS(Database Autonomy Service)提供:
- 自动扩缩容
- 智能限流
- SQL 优化建议
- 性能预测与异常检测
2. SQL 优化工具
- 提供 SQL 执行计划分析、索引推荐等功能,帮助用户优化慢查询。
📊 七、对比传统自建 MySQL 的优势
| 对比项 | 自建 MySQL | 阿里云 MySQL |
|---|---|---|
| 硬件成本 | 高(需采购服务器) | 按需付费,弹性伸缩 |
| 维护难度 | 复杂(需 DBA) | 托管服务,一键维护 |
| 高可用 | 自行搭建 | 天然支持 HA |
| 数据安全 | 易出错 | 自动备份+加密 |
| 性能优化 | 需手动调优 | 智能调优 + 参数推荐 |
| 网络延迟 | 可能较高 | 内网直连,低延迟 |
✅ 总结:阿里云 MySQL 快的原因
一句话总结:
阿里云 MySQL 是建立在高性能硬件 + 云端优化架构 + 数据库智能管理之上的一体化解决方案,不仅性能强,而且易用、稳定、安全。
如果你正在考虑使用或迁移至阿里云 MySQL,可以根据业务规模选择合适的实例类型(如通用型、独享型、读写分离型等),并配合 DAS 进行智能化管理,可以获得最佳性能体验。
如需进一步了解某一方面(比如如何优化 SQL、读写分离配置、DAS 使用等),欢迎继续提问!
秒懂云